Programs

  • Vidya Spoorthi

    States

    Karnataka

    Book Drive: This is an yearly activity focusing on supporting the schooling materials for the children who can’t afford the same on the grounds of poor family background. 2. Guest Teachers: We provide teaching staff to the schools where there are aspiring children to study but no adequate teachers, most of the support is done in the rural schools. 3. Aksharabhyas Learning centre: This is an evening learning centre where children will have the extra cushion of tuition. We have two such centres helping more than 25 students in each activity. Two locations are a) Pulaganahalli b) Harihara 4. Computer Labs: We believe in digital learning for the children in urban schools or rural schools, we have been organising the computer labs with the teachers so that the children have the privilege to learn computers on par with today’s living. 5. Gift a Toilet to a Girl child: This is an unique activity which focuses on providing the basic hygiene infrastructure to the girls by building toilets in the schools where there are no toilets and the children are forced on open defecation. We have successfully completed more than 20 projects till today. 6. Renovation and restoration: Under this activity we support the renovation and restoration of bad shaped schools be it compound wall or the white wash. There are many schools we have helped with this activity. 7. Scholarship: This initiative is currently focused on identifying people who are in need of this kind of support, specifically in Karnataka, the state in which Kritagyata carries out its functions, to help them in pursuing quality education.

  • Myhome

    District
    District

    Bangalore

    MY HOME is a shelter hosting 13 girls who are either orphaned or have a single parent. They are provided holistic support and are taken care of with utmost affection and care. Our aim is to equip these children with a good education and a support system, so that they can become independent, confident and well prepared to take upon the challenges one encounters in various facets of life. We wish to inculcate in them a positive and a strong attitude towards life, and to build a value system in them so that they become capable of overcoming any hurdles that they face. Since MY HOME is run by the donations we receive both in cash and kind, every little bit makes a really big difference in the lives of these girls.   • Prerana

    States

    Karnataka

    Prerana is a women oriented program which focuses on the women We have two different verticals under this activity one is the livelihood program which is supporting 60+ women who are learning tailoring on Industrial grade tailoring machines making them industry ready to work in any companies or giving them work which can help them in developing the sustainable living which can support them and their families. A dedicated teacher who formally teaches tailoring with lots of dedication and commitment.

Impact

Kritagyata Trust has benefited more than 40,000 children and women through its various projects and programmes, and currently takes care of 13 children in their Children Home.

Vision and Mission

Mission:To empower, engage and educate children and women from lower sections of the society, so that they are able to stand up for themselves and find their voice in a society that needs to be built on respect, dignity and equality for every individual, regardless of their gender, caste or class.
Vision:To be a guiding force for children and women who find it difficult to fulfill their most basic needs by enabling them to build a better life for themselves, by having a community based approach for their development.

To inspire, motivate and encourage people to come together and take responsibility for making a better society for individuals on the margins, by using their access and privilege to help someone else.

To make these children and women discover their full potential, and equipping them with skills to ensure that they can utilize this potential.
